Output 114a156b37f5da8e7117f4040eea2fd6e9f6768a862c0dcc1cf180297687e7c8:2

value
5000000
script pubkey
OP_0 OP_PUSHBYTES_20 d8fab138e5e7135c4390ec573a2941aa18d5bba1
address
bc1qmratzw89uuf4csusa3tn522p4gvdtwapqhazx9
transaction
114a156b37f5da8e7117f4040eea2fd6e9f6768a862c0dcc1cf180297687e7c8
spent
true